掌握Linux的字符替换命令,拓展功能大法!(linux字符替换命令)

随着智能设备的不断普及,使用linux系统的人也越来越多了。Linux是一个强大的操作系统,拥有很多强大的功能,其中具有很强的文本处理功能,其中字符替换的功能尤其强大,使得我们能够用Linux实现更节省时间的任务处理。

字符替换允许我们使用内置的Linux命令来实现一些文本处理过程。其中最常用的命令是“sed”,它可以从一个文本文件中搜索出指定的文本,并用指定的字符替换它。它的语法结构是“sed”后面跟着替换字符的模型,例如:

sed ‘s/old/new/g’ file

这条命令会在文件中搜索old字段,并把它替换成new字段。

此外,Linux还提供了另一个字符替换的命令叫“tr”,它的功能更加强大,它可以把一个字符替换成另一个字符,也可以把一个字符替换成一组字符,还可以用来替换字母表中的字符。例如,用“tr”替换字符串中的空格:

echo “hello world” | tr ‘ ‘ ‘*’

结果:

hello*world

再例如,用“tr”替换字母表中的字符:

echo “ryksm” | tr ‘A-M’ ‘N-Z’

结果:

sznlt

总之,Linux提供了强大的文本处理功能,其中字符替换命令可以大大提高文本处理的效率,了解其工作原理,能够大大拓展Linux的功能,增强工作效率。

版权声明:本文采用知识共享 署名4.0国际许可协议 [BY-NC-SA] 进行授权
文章名称:《掌握Linux的字符替换命令,拓展功能大法!(linux字符替换命令)》
文章链接:https://zhuji.vsping.com/152722.html
本站资源仅供个人学习交流,请于下载后24小时内删除,不允许用于商业用途,否则法律问题自行承担。